收藏 分销(赏)

软件项目管理的风险来自于软件项目.doc

上传人:丰**** 文档编号:3631574 上传时间:2024-07-11 格式:DOC 页数:7 大小:46KB
下载 相关 举报
软件项目管理的风险来自于软件项目.doc_第1页
第1页 / 共7页
软件项目管理的风险来自于软件项目.doc_第2页
第2页 / 共7页
软件项目管理的风险来自于软件项目.doc_第3页
第3页 / 共7页
软件项目管理的风险来自于软件项目.doc_第4页
第4页 / 共7页
软件项目管理的风险来自于软件项目.doc_第5页
第5页 / 共7页
点击查看更多>>
资源描述

1、精品文档就在这里-各类专业好文档,值得你下载,教育,管理,论文,制度,方案手册,应有尽有-软件项目管理的风险来自于软件项目自身的特点: 软件产品不可见:开发的进展以及软件的质量是否符合要求难于度量,从而使软件的管理难于 把握。 软件的生产过程不存在绝对正确的过程形式:可以肯定的是不同的软件开发项目应当采用不 同的或者说是有针对性的软件开发过程,而真正合适的软件开发过程是在软件项目的开发完成才能 明了的。因此项目开发之初只能根据项目的特点和开发经验进行选择,并在开发过程中不断的调整 。 大型软件项目往往是一次性的。以往的经验可以被借鉴的地方不多。回避和控制软件管理 风险的唯一办法就是设立监督制度

2、,项目开发中任何较大的决定都必须有主要技术环节甚至是由用 户参与进行的。在该项目中项目监督由项目开发中的质量监督组来实施。 一般参与软件开发的人员(包括管理者和技术人员)和其责任进行分析如下: 参与者 项目经理1人 主要职责:进行全局把握,侧重于项目的商务方面,充当项目组同客户正式交流的接口环节。 项目负责人1人 主要职责:制定项目开发计划和开发策略,参与项目核心系统的分析设计,同时努力保证开发 计划的按时完成和开发策略的真正贯彻落实。 领域专家1或2人 主要职责:在软件分析阶段帮助分析人员界定系统实现边界和实现的功能,对特定检测点进行 算法审核,同时对测试策略和软件操作界面提出参考意见。 质

3、量监督组1或2人 主要职责:编制软件质量控制计划,并负责落实;控制必要文档的生产,通过文档,监督项目 实施过程中软件的质量,并产生软件质量报告,提请项目经理和项目负责人审阅;对于项目中出现 的质量问题,主持召开质量复审会议。 系统分析员1或2人 主要职责:协同项目负责人进行软件系统的分析和设计工作,书写软件需求分析和系统设计相 关文档。在软件实现阶段进行测试策略的编制和对性能测试的指导。 程序员2或3人 主要职责:协助分析人员进行详细设计,和软件系统的代码实现,并进行适当的白盒测试。 测试员2或3人 主要职责:已经实现的软件组件、构件或系统进行正确性验证测试,整合后的系统的性能测 试等。书写测

4、试报告和测试统计报告提请质量监督组复审。 技术支持2或3人 主要职责:协同系统分析人员听取用户需求,对需求分析进行参考性复审。协同测试人员进行 测试,书写操作手册和在线帮助,在项目交付用户之后进行跟踪服务。 文档组1或2人 主要职责:对各部门产生的文档进行格式规范、版本编号和控制、存档文件的检索;协助质量 监督组进行软件质量监督。 通过适当的人员配备和职责划分,能有效的降低软件开发在后期的失 控的可能性,和软件对关键人员的依赖性。 软件技术风险 本系统拟订采用的两个重大的软件技术是面向对象的构件和基于微软的COM组件技术。组件和 构件技术都是为了提高软件的可靠性和软件的可扩展性而采用的技术手段

5、。从技术成熟度上说不存 在风险,但为了实现良好的软件构架和稳定的组件,与传统开发方法比较,有相当的多的额外工作 需要做,这会给项目工期带来较大的风险。 回避和控制这部分风险的办法是在项目进行的过程不断的对该阶段进行风险估计和指定有效的 里程碑。同时采用范例方式提高开发人员的构件组件的分析识别能力,适时调整构件组件的数量 和粒度。 软件过程风险 软件需求阶段的风险 软件的开发是以用户的需求开始,在大多数情况下,用户需求要靠软件开发方诱导才能保证需 求的完整,再以书面的形式形成用户需求这一重要的文档。需求分析更多的是开发方确认需求 的可行性和一致性的过程,在此阶段需要和用户进行广泛的交流和确认。需

6、求和需求分析的任何疏 漏造成的损失会在软件系统的后续阶段被一级一级地放大,因此本阶段的风险最大。 设计阶段的风险 设计的主要目的在于软件的功能正确的反映了需求。可见需求的不完整和对需求分析的不完整 和错误,在设计阶段被成倍地放大。设计阶段的主要任务是完成系统体系结构的定义,使之能够完 成需求阶段的即定目标;另一方面也是检验需求的一致性和需求分析的完整性和正确性。 设计本身的风险主要来自于系统分析人员。分析人员在设计系统结构时过于定制,系统的可扩 展性较弱,会给后期维护带来巨大的负担,和维护成本的激增。对用户来说系统的使用比例会有明 显的折扣,甚至造成软件寿命过短。反之,软件结构的过于灵活和通用

7、,必然引起软件实现的难度 增加,系统的复杂度会上升,这又会在实现和测试阶段带来风险,系统的稳定性也会受到影响。从 另一个角度上看,业务规则的变化,或说用户需求和将来软件运行环境的变化都是必然的情况,目 前软件设计的所谓通用性是否就能很好的适应将来需求和运行环境的的变化,是需要认真折衷的 。这种折中也蕴涵着很大的风险。 设计阶段蕴涵的另一种风险来自于设计文档。文档的不健全不仅会造成实现阶段的困难,更会 在后期的测试和维护造成灾难性的后果,例如根本无法对软件系统进行版本升级,甚至是发现的简 单错误都无从更正。 实现阶段引入的风险 软件的实现从某种意义上讲是软件代码的生产。原代码本身也是文档的一部分

8、,同时它又是将 来运行于计算机系统之上的实体。源代码书写的规范性,可读性是该阶段的主要风险来源。规范的 代码生产会把属于程序员自身个性风格的成分引入代码的比例降到最低限度,从而减小了系统整合 的风险。 维护阶段的风险 软件维护包含两个主要的维护阶段,一个是软件生产完毕到软件试运行阶段的维护,这个阶段 是一种实环境的测试性维护,其主要目的是发现在测试环境中不能或未发现的问题;另一个阶段是 当软件的运行不再能适应用户业务需求或是用户的运行环境(包括硬件平台,软件环境等)时进行 的软件维护,具体可能是软件的版本升级或软件移植等。 从软件工程的角度看,软件维护费用约占总费用的55%70%,系统越大,该

9、费用越高。对系统 可维护性的轻视是大型软件系统的最大风险。在软件漫长的运营期内,业务规则肯定会不断发展, 科学的解决此问题的做法是不断对软件系统进行版本升级,在确保可维护性的前提下逐步扩展系统 。 在软件系统运营期间,主要的风险源自于技术支持体系的无效运转。科学的方法是有一支客户 支持队伍不断收集运行中发现的问题,并将解决问题的方法传授给软件系统的所有使用者。 项目风险表 风险评估表中所提到的风险是一般项目在开发过程中都客观存在的,表中所列出的风险系数是 指在不对风险进行深入的分析和有效的规避的情况下,该风险项发生的概率。比如软件产品的设计 目标是运行十年,体系结构不合理的风险是40%的含义是

10、,如果不对系统进行深入的分析,未采用 最合理的软件技术进行设计,则生产出一个不具备可扩展性的软件系统的概率是40%。由于客户公 司是仍将不断发展的,在十年内,该软件系统都能满足公司运营要求的可能性极低。由此而可能产 生的灾难性后果是公司在业务发展的时候,必须重新开发新系统。 向客户提供风险评估,是按照国际惯例进行的例行操作,一方面让客户对潜在的风险有更充分 的了解,表明公司诚信 为本的态度,另一方面也用以鞭策和激励全体开发人员严格执行开发标准 ,共同监督项目开发过程,努力避免风险的发生。 - 风险 概率 影响 - 规模估计过低 60% 严重的 交付期限太紧张 50% 严重的 用户需求变化频繁

11、75% 严重的 技术达不到预期效果 30% 轻微的 质量保证体系的措施实施不利 60% 严重的 软件体系结构设计不合理 40% 灾难性的 人员流动 30% 严重的 3、通过活动,使学生养成博览群书的好习惯。B比率分析法和比较分析法不能测算出各因素的影响程度。C采用约当产量比例法,分配原材料费用与分配加工费用所用的完工率都是一致的。C采用直接分配法分配辅助生产费用时,应考虑各辅助生产车间之间相互提供产品或劳务的情况。错 C产品的实际生产成本包括废品损失和停工损失。C成本报表是对外报告的会计报表。C成本分析的首要程序是发现问题、分析原因。C成本会计的对象是指成本核算。C成本计算的辅助方法一般应与基

12、本方法结合使用而不单独使用。C成本计算方法中的最基本的方法是分步法。XD当车间生产多种产品时,“废品损失”、“停工损失”的借方余额,月末均直接记入该产品的产品成本 中。D定额法是为了简化成本计算而采用的一种成本计算方法。F“废品损失”账户月末没有余额。F废品损失是指在生产过程中发现和入库后发现的不可修复废品的生产成本和可修复废品的修复费用。F分步法的一个重要特点是各步骤之间要进行成本结转。()G各月末在产品数量变化不大的产品,可不计算月末在产品成本。错G工资费用就是成本项目。()G归集在基本生产车间的制造费用最后均应分配计入产品成本中。对J计算计时工资费用,应以考勤记录中的工作时间记录为依据。

13、()J简化的分批法就是不计算在产品成本的分批法。()J简化分批法是不分批计算在产品成本的方法。对 J加班加点工资既可能是直接计人费用,又可能是间接计人费用。J接生产工艺过程的特点,工业企业的生产可分为大量生产、成批生产和单件生产三种,XK可修复废品是指技术上可以修复使用的废品。错K可修复废品是指经过修理可以使用,而不管修复费用在经济上是否合算的废品。P品种法只适用于大量大批的单步骤生产的企业。Q企业的制造费用一定要通过“制造费用”科目核算。Q企业职工的医药费、医务部门、职工浴室等部门职工的工资,均应通过“应付工资”科目核算。 S生产车间耗用的材料,全部计入“直接材料”成本项目。 S适应生产特点

14、和管理要求,采用适当的成本计算方法,是成本核算的基础工作。()W完工产品费用等于月初在产品费用加本月生产费用减月末在产品费用。对Y“预提费用”可能出现借方余额,其性质属于资产,实际上是待摊费用。对 Y引起资产和负债同时减少的支出是费用性支出。XY以应付票据去偿付购买材料的费用,是成本性支出。XY原材料分工序一次投入与原材料在每道工序陆续投入,其完工率的计算方法是完全一致的。Y运用连环替代法进行分析,即使随意改变各构成因素的替换顺序,各因素的影响结果加总后仍等于指标的总差异,因此更换各因索替换顺序,不会影响分析的结果。()Z在产品品种规格繁多的情况下,应该采用分类法计算产品成本。对Z直接生产费用就是直接计人费用。XZ逐步结转分步法也称为计列半成品分步法。A按年度计划分配率分配制造费用,“制造费用”账户月末(可能有月末余额/可能有借方余额/可能有贷方余额/可能无月末余额)。A按年度计划分配率分配制造费用的方法适用于(季节性生产企业)-精品 文档-

展开阅读全文
相似文档                                   自信AI助手自信AI助手
猜你喜欢                                   自信AI导航自信AI导航
搜索标签

当前位置:首页 > 包罗万象 > 大杂烩

移动网页_全站_页脚广告1

关于我们      便捷服务       自信AI       AI导航        获赠5币

©2010-2024 宁波自信网络信息技术有限公司  版权所有

客服电话:4008-655-100  投诉/维权电话:4009-655-100

gongan.png浙公网安备33021202000488号   

icp.png浙ICP备2021020529号-1  |  浙B2-20240490  

关注我们 :gzh.png    weibo.png    LOFTER.png 

客服